FC Dallas vs Chicago Fire: Gameday Primer, How To Watch, & Open Thread

Lineups, streaming info, and live MLS coverage as the Fire face off against FC Dallas

MLS: FC Dallas at Chicago Fire Mike DiNovo-USA TODAY Sports

FC Dallas vs Chicago Fire

Saturday, July 14th, 2018

MLS Week 20 | Toyota Stadium, Frisco TX

Kickoff: 7:00pm CT

Referee: Marcos Deoliveira

Assistant Referees: Cameron Blanchard, Danny Thornberry

4th Official: Alejandro Mariscal

VAR: Ismail Elfath


The Fire suffered one of their toughest losses of the season on Wednesday at home to Philadelphia. It was a big setback for their playoff hopes but, more importantly, it was demoralizing for the players and fans. Somehow the team has to put it behind them and take on a Dallas side nursing an 11-game home unbeaten streak. What could possibly go wrong?
